Since you can still push to another machine also running Git/Mercurial/Bzr/etc you still have the multi-computer backup safety, which you’d hopefully have either way. However if you ever code while traveling, having full repository access can be a huge plus, then just resync to your server when you have a net connection again/get home/etc.
